Meaning of "time to score"

time to score: This phrase is commonly used in sports or games to indicate an opportune moment or period when a player, team, or individual has the chance to gain points, win a competition, achieve success, or accomplish a goal. It implies a critical or decisive moment where one's performance can lead to a favorable outcome or victory
